网站大量收购独家精品文档,联系QQ:2885784924

自适应差分进化算法的改进及研究.docxVIP

  1. 1、本文档共10页,可阅读全部内容。
  2. 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  5. 5、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  6. 6、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  7. 7、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  8. 8、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多

自适应差分进化算法的改进及研究

一、引言

自适应差分进化算法(AdaptiveDifferentialEvolutionAlgorithm,ADEA)作为一种高效的全局优化搜索算法,其具备很强的探索能力和优秀的求解效率。随着科技的不断发展,该算法在多个领域得到了广泛应用。然而,随着问题复杂度的增加,传统的差分进化算法在处理高维、非线性、多模态等复杂问题时,仍存在一定局限性。因此,对自适应差分进化算法的改进研究显得尤为重要。本文旨在探讨自适应差分进化算法的改进方法及其在相关领域的应用研究。

二、自适应差分进化算法概述

自适应差分进化算法是一种基于差分进化算法的改进型算法。它通过引入自适应机制,使得算法在搜索过程中能够根据问题的特性和搜索情况,自动调整搜索策略,从而提高算法的搜索效率和求解质量。其核心思想是通过变异、交叉和选择等操作,生成新的解集,并在解集的演化过程中逐渐逼近最优解。

三、自适应差分进化算法的改进

针对传统差分进化算法的局限性,本文提出以下几种改进方法:

1.引入动态调整策略:根据问题的特性和搜索情况,动态调整算法的参数,如变异因子、交叉概率等,以适应不同的问题需求。

2.引入局部搜索策略:在全局搜索的基础上,引入局部搜索策略,以加快算法的收敛速度并提高求解精度。

3.引入多种群策略:通过将种群划分为多个子种群,并在各个子种群间进行信息交流和协作,提高算法的多样性和全局搜索能力。

4.引入自适应性学习机制:通过分析历史搜索信息,自动调整算法的搜索策略和参数,以适应问题的动态变化。

四、改进后的自适应差分进化算法应用研究

经过上述改进后,自适应差分进化算法在处理高维、非线性、多模态等复杂问题时表现出更好的性能。本文通过以下应用研究验证了改进后的算法的有效性:

1.函数优化问题:将改进后的自适应差分进化算法应用于一系列标准测试函数,验证其在函数优化问题中的性能。

2.图像处理问题:利用改进后的算法进行图像分割、图像恢复等任务,验证其在图像处理领域的应用效果。

3.机器学习问题:将改进后的算法应用于机器学习领域的分类、聚类等问题,验证其在机器学习问题中的求解能力。

五、结论

通过对自适应差分进化算法的改进及研究,本文提出了一种具有动态调整策略、局部搜索策略、多种群策略和自适应性学习机制的改进型算法。经过应用研究验证,该算法在处理高维、非线性、多模态等复杂问题时表现出更好的性能和求解效率。未来,我们将继续深入研究该算法在其他领域的应用,并进一步优化算法的性能,以满足更多实际问题的需求。

六、算法的改进细节

针对自适应差分进化算法的改进,我们从多个方面进行了深入的探讨和实践。下面将详细介绍改进的算法所涉及的几个关键点。

1.动态调整策略

为了增强算法的灵活性和适应性,我们引入了动态调整策略。该策略根据问题的特性和搜索过程中的反馈信息,实时调整算法的参数和搜索策略。例如,当算法陷入局部最优时,我们通过增加种群的多样性来跳出局部最优;当搜索进度缓慢时,我们通过增加搜索力度来加快搜索速度。

2.局部搜索策略

为了提高算法的局部搜索能力,我们引入了局部搜索策略。在每一次全局搜索后,算法会进入局部搜索阶段。在局部搜索阶段,算法会利用一些启发式信息,如梯度信息、局部最优解的邻域信息等,来进一步优化当前解。这样,算法可以在保持种群多样性的同时,提高局部搜索的精度。

3.多种群策略

为了增强算法的全局搜索能力,我们采用了多种群策略。在该策略下,算法会初始化多个种群,每个种群独立地进行搜索。种群之间通过信息交换和竞争来保持多样性。这样,算法可以在全局范围内进行更有效的搜索,从而提高找到全局最优解的概率。

4.自适应性学习机制

为了使算法能够适应问题的动态变化,我们引入了自适应性学习机制。该机制通过分析历史搜索信息,自动调整算法的搜索策略和参数。例如,当算法在某个区域的搜索效果不佳时,机制会自动调整该区域的搜索力度和搜索策略;当新的有效信息出现时,机制会及时更新解的空间分布和搜索方向。

七、实验设计与分析

为了验证改进后的自适应差分进化算法的有效性,我们设计了多组实验。实验主要分为两部分:一部分是对标准测试函数的应用研究,另一部分是对实际问题的应用研究。

在标准测试函数的应用研究中,我们选择了多个高维、非线性、多模态的测试函数。通过将这些测试函数应用于改进后的算法,我们分析了算法的性能和求解效率。实验结果显示,改进后的算法在处理这些测试函数时表现出更好的性能和求解效率。

在实际问题的应用研究中,我们将改进后的算法应用于图像处理和机器学习等领域。在图像处理领域,我们利用算法进行图像分割、图像恢复等任务;在机器学习领域,我们将算法应用于分类、聚类等问题。实验结果显示,改进后的算法在这些实际问题中也表现出较好的性能和求解

文档评论(0)

便宜高质量专业写作 + 关注
实名认证
服务提供商

专注于报告、文案、学术类文档写作

1亿VIP精品文档

相关文档